Man Found Dead on Sidewalk in Odenton After Shooting Incident

Authorities are investigating a shooting that resulted in the death of a man in an Odenton neighborhood on Saturday night. Police responded to a report of gunfire in the 500 block of Williamsburg Lane and discovered the victim on the sidewalk.

The man had sustained multiple gunshot wounds and was pronounced dead at the scene by emergency responders. As of now, the Anne Arundel County Police have not provided further details regarding the incident.

This incident marks the latest in a series of violent occurrences in the area. According to police records, there have been at least four homicides in Anne Arundel County since the beginning of the year. The first homicide was reported in January when Timothy Leslie Randolph, 45, from Baltimore, was fatally shot in Odenton.

Subsequent incidents included the deaths of a man and woman found shot in a home in Harwood, as well as a shooting involving contracted security personnel at Northrop Grumman’s Linthicum campus.
